发明名称 Beverages container pressure monitoring method
摘要 To determine the internal pressure in containers of beverages, in cans a pressure distortion is detected through an electrical current designed for polymonomers with additives such as ruthenium atoms to give a number of oxidation conditions. The extraction or feed of electrons and the application of a voltage gives a colour change, or there is a colour change without a voltage in a thin polyaniline film. Other aniline derivatives can be used to form polymers, colours and sequences. With corked bottles, a pressure sensor is used which reacts to pressure and gives an electric voltage to give colour changes which can be viewed in a window. The pressure receiver can be an adhesive film of polyvinylidene fluoride (PVF2), to interact with a conductive film of at least one polyaniline polymer derivative, to show when the pressurised container can be opened at the optimum temp. For cans at least one corrugated and pliable membrane is used to give proportional pressure measurements. For corked bottles, a piezo element such as of PVF2 is applied near the contents level.
